Pro League: Another setback! Indian men's hockey team suffers 5th straight defeat

The Indian men's hockey team faced a defeat against Australia in the FIH Pro League. India initially led with a 2-0 score, thanks to Abhishek's goals. However, Australia made a strong comeback in the second half. They scored three goals to win the match 3-2. This loss marks India's fifth consecutive defeat in the tournament.
